Hi everyone

We have a situation where we are using a daughter's mom as a cosigner. The lender wants to use the mom's 2 month old mortgage application for the installment loan. My worry is that the mortgage application has GMI on it. Being that this is a cosigner situation, does that come into play?

There's no regulatory requirement to have a written application for a car loan - only on purchase or refinance of principle dwellings. So this really is a question of your bank's procedures. If the loan officer copies the "old" application, be sure GMI information is copied as this would be a violation of Reg B (over collection of GMI on a non-applicable loan).
